Aamir Khan Makes Donation To PM-CARES Fund & CM Relief Fund

Aamir Khan has donated to PM-CARES Fund and CM Relief Fund and also has pledged to help the daily wage workers of Laal Singh Chaddha. Read below to know more.

Amidst the coronavirus outbreak many prominent personalities have come forward to help the weaker section of the society and also to help the government eradicate the novel coronavirus. Meanwhile, Aamir Khan has also stepped forward to make donations to the PM-CARES Fund and CM Relief Fund.

However, the sources say that Aamir has also already made the contribution. He also made contributions to the filmmaker’s association and a few NGOs. The PK actor has also donated to the daily wage workers of his upcoming film Laal Singh Chaddha. The shooting of the film has currently been suspended due to the coronavirus outbreak.

Till now, many B-Town celebs have donated to the PM-CARES Fund and various other organizations that are helping the needy.

Akshay Kumar was the first celebrity to donate Rs. 25 crores to the PM-CARES Fund. Salman Khan has pledged to transfer money into the accounts of the daily wage earners in the cine industry. Shah Rukh Khan’s group of companies, Kolkata Knight Riders, Red Chillies Entertainment, Meer Foundation and Red Chillies VFX announced several initiatives to support the efforts of Prime Minister Narendra Modi and Cheif Minister Udhav Thackeray in their fight against the COVID-19 outbreak in the nation.

Shah Rukh Khan even lent away his 4-storey office building to BMC to help them extend the quarantine facilities for the women, elderly people, and children.
